If you want to know some other fun facts about him, here they are:

  • He once urged his listeners to all go to a random sports blog he picked from out of a hat to show his power, taking a small blog that constantly criticizes ESPN's business practices down for over 48 hours.
  • He hates and constantly insults the NBA player John Wall because he danced one time. He blames this dance on poor leadership skills that he also attributes to John Wall's father going to prison and dying of cancer when Wall was 9 years old.
  • He insulted the NFL player Sean Taylor, who was murdered several years ago during a robbery of his home. Cowherd said his death was inevitable because of Taylor's history and the murder was clearly one of revenge. Even after it was revealed that the robbers who killed him did not know him personally, he refused to apologize for his words.
  • He says that if you live in Indiana or Ohio, you're bringing unemployment onto yourself.
